3. Conciseness imperative
The “conciseness imperative” holds paramount importance when crafting textual descriptions for kindergarten graduation visuals on Instagram. The platform’s design, user behavior, and content consumption patterns necessitate brevity and impactful language.
-
Character Limits and Readability
Instagram imposes character limits on captions, directly forcing concise wording. Furthermore, lengthy texts are often truncated, diminishing visibility. Descriptions must efficiently convey the message within these constraints to ensure complete readability and prevent critical information from being hidden behind a “see more” prompt. For example, “Congrats, [Name]! Kindergarten complete!” is preferable to a multi-sentence paragraph conveying the same sentiment.
-
User Attention Span
Social media users typically scan content quickly. Extended descriptions are frequently overlooked. Short, impactful statements capture attention more effectively, increasing the likelihood of engagement. A brief, celebratory phrase like “Officially a graduate!” is more likely to resonate than a detailed account of the graduation ceremony.
-
Visual Dominance of the Platform
Instagram is a visually driven platform. Text descriptions serve to complement, not dominate, the image or video. Overly verbose captions detract from the visual content, reducing its impact. A succinct caption such as “[Name]’s Graduation Day!” appropriately supports the visual narrative without overshadowing it.
-
Mobile-First Consumption
The majority of Instagram users access the platform via mobile devices with smaller screens. Long paragraphs are particularly cumbersome to read on mobile. Concise captions ensure a positive user experience, maximizing engagement and reducing the cognitive load on the viewer. A short, emotive phrase like “So proud!” is well-suited for mobile consumption.
These factors underscore the critical necessity for concise communication. Effective descriptions accompanying kindergarten graduation visuals prioritize impactful language and brevity, optimizing readability, engagement, and overall platform performance. The constraint fosters creativity, pushing content creators to distill their message into its most essential and resonant form.

8. Hashtag integration
Effective hashtag integration significantly influences the reach and discoverability of kindergarten graduation captions on a popular image-sharing platform. The strategic application of relevant hashtags categorizes the content, thereby facilitating its retrieval by users searching for specific themes or events. The absence of appropriate hashtags reduces the visibility of the post, limiting its potential impact and engagement. For instance, a caption devoid of hashtags will primarily reach the poster’s existing network, while the inclusion of #KindergartenGraduation and #ClassOf2024 broadens its exposure to users interested in these topics.
The selection of hashtags should align with the content’s subject matter and target audience. General hashtags like #Graduation can increase visibility but may also result in the post being lost amidst a high volume of similar content. More specific hashtags, such as #[SchoolName]Graduation or #[CityName]Kindergarten, target a narrower audience but may generate higher engagement within that group. Combining general and specific hashtags represents a common strategy for optimizing reach and relevance. Furthermore, branded hashtags, created and promoted by educational institutions or event organizers, can foster community engagement and facilitate content aggregation. The utilization of trending hashtags, provided they remain relevant and appropriate, can also amplify visibility, but requires careful monitoring to avoid association with unrelated or inappropriate content.
In conclusion, the integration of relevant hashtags constitutes a critical component of successful kindergarten graduation captions. Strategic hashtag selection enhances content discoverability, facilitates audience engagement, and contributes to the overall impact of the post. The absence of appropriate hashtags limits reach, while the misuse of irrelevant or trending hashtags can detract from the message and potentially damage the poster’s reputation. The proper implementation of hashtag integration represents a fundamental aspect of effective social media communication.

Frequently Asked Questions
This section addresses common inquiries regarding the creation and utilization of textual descriptions accompanying kindergarten graduation visuals on a popular social media platform.
Question 1: What is the appropriate length for a kindergarten graduation caption on Instagram?
The platform favors brevity. Captions should ideally remain under 125 characters to ensure complete visibility without truncation. Conciseness enhances readability and maximizes engagement.
Question 2: Should hashtags always be included in these captions?
Strategic hashtag integration is recommended. Relevant hashtags enhance discoverability and expand the post’s reach. However, overuse can appear spammy and detract from the message.
Question 3: How can personalization be achieved without compromising a child’s privacy?
Personalization can focus on general achievements and milestones rather than specific, identifying details. Refrain from including addresses, full names, or sensitive information.
Question 4: Is it necessary to maintain a consistently celebratory tone?
A celebratory tone is generally advisable. However, authenticity is paramount. Genuine expressions of pride and joy resonate more effectively than forced enthusiasm.
Question 5: What are some common mistakes to avoid when writing these captions?
Avoid generic, uninspired language. Refrain from excessive self-promotion or negativity. Ensure grammatical correctness and typographical accuracy.
Question 6: Can these captions be repurposed for other social media platforms?
Adaptation is often required. Character limits and platform-specific conventions may necessitate modifications. Consider the target audience and platform characteristics.
